187,455 Shares in Vistra Corp. $VST Acquired by Advent International L.P.

Advent International L.P. acquired a new stake in Vistra Corp. (NYSE:VSTFree Report) in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m acquired 187,455 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$28,180,000. Vistra makes up 0.7% of Advent International L.P.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 17th largest position. Advent International L.P. owned about 0.06% of Vistra as of its most recent SEC filing.

Vistra Trading Down 0.1%

Shares of VST opened at $163.15 on Monday. Vistra Corp. has a fifty-two week low of $132.66 and a fifty-two week high of $219.82. The company has a market capitalization of $55.01 billion, a PE ratio of 27.33 and a beta of 1.40. The stock has a fifty day moving average of $156.05 and a two-hundred day moving average of $158.44.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 5.51, a quick ratio of 0.79 and a current ratio of 0.90.

Vistra (NYSE:VST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 7th. The company reported $2.87 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.32 by $1.55. The business had revenue of $5.64 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$5.22 billion. Vistra had a return on equity of 105.64% and a net margin of 11.52%. As a group, analysts forecast that Vistra Corp. will post 9.52 EPS for the current year.

Vistra Profile

(Free Report)

Vistra (NYSE: VST) is an integrated power company that develops, owns and operates electricity generation and retail businesses in the United States. The company’s operations span wholesale power production—through a diversified fleet of thermal and lower‑carbon generation assets—and retail electricity supply to residential, commercial and industrial customers. Vistra serves organized wholesale markets and competitive retail markets, with a notable presence in Texas and other regional U.S. power markets.

Vistra’s core activities include the ownership and operation of generation facilities, the commercial dispatch and optimization of those assets into wholesale markets, and the sale of electricity and related services to end-use customers through its retail brands.
